What You’ll Do
As a Project Manager I, you will lead low to medium complexity projects to achieve Total Project Success—meeting scope, schedule, budget, and quality objectives—while serving as the primary client contact and coordinating multi-discipline teams. Every colleague has a voice and a stake in our success through our ESOP, and we are driven by our mission to make a positive difference for our clients, colleagues, and communities.
- Confirm scope and requirements with clients and stakeholders with support from the CRM or Operations Director as needed.
- Ensure contracts are fully executed by the appropriate Principal and align team to contractual obligations.
- Develop proposals and help build financial plans; confirm staffing and preliminary man-hour budgets with Senior PM/CRM/Operations.
- Lead effective project kick-offs to align scope, standards, budgets, roles, and expectations; foster ownership and trust.
- Work with discipline leads to finalize work plans and detailed task-hour budgets; update plans as conditions change.
- Establish schedules with client input; set interim milestones for timely information flow and coordination.
- Schedule and sequence work; communicate action items; monitor manpower requirements across disciplines and maintain profit variance within targets.
- Maintain complete project documentation and organized storage so information is current and accessible.
- Facilitate meetings with owners, clients, and architects; document decisions and follow-ups.
- Monitor budget and fee burn; recognize how hours charged impact revenue and forecasts; identify and process additional services as needed.
- Prepare and implement proactive QA/QC plans; coordinate timely reviews and submittals to meet standards.
- Identify risks to quality, schedule, or financial goals; analyze root causes, propose mitigation, and escalate when needed.
- Oversee Construction Administration to support conformance of installed systems with design intent and quality standards.
- Ensure accurate invoices are issued promptly; track AR status and update projected monthly revenue.
- Supervise close-out: punchlist coordination, documentation, filings, lessons learned, and project archive.
- Engage in ongoing training; deepen technical discipline knowledge and project leadership skills; support business development with existing clients.
Who We’re Looking For
Minimum Requirements:
- Technical or Bachelor’s degree in one of the major technical disciplines practiced by the firm with four years related project experience OR
- Ten years of practical experience on similar projects
- Professional Engineer Licensure preferred (required by those who have a ABET accredited degree in engineering)
Preferred Qualifications:
- Experience managing multi-discipline design teams and coordinating with subconsultants and contractors.
- Working knowledge of project financials including fees, change orders, earned value, and forecasts.
- Proficiency with Microsoft Office and comfort with scheduling/resource planning tools.
- Clear, concise communication and meeting facilitation; strong documentation and follow-through.
- Ability to analyze issues, evaluate options, and make sound decisions in collaboration with stakeholders.

How to Get Visa Sponsorship in Smith Seckman Reid Visa Sponsorship USA
Target engineering and technical roles
Smith Seckman Reid's sponsorship activity is concentrated in technical disciplines aligned with its engineering consulting work. Focus your application on roles where a specialized degree is a clear requirement, not just a preference, to strengthen your H-1B eligibility.
Understand the H-1B specialty occupation standard
SSR sponsors primarily through H-1B, which requires the role to qualify as a specialty occupation. Before applying, confirm your target position requires a degree in a specific field, not just any bachelor's degree, to avoid issues during petition review.
Apply well ahead of the H-1B lottery deadline
H-1B registrations open in March for an October 1 start date. Targeting Smith Seckman Reid roles in the preceding months gives you time to secure an offer, allow HR to prepare, and register before the window closes.

How do I approach the application timeline when targeting Smith Seckman Reid for H-1B sponsorship?
Work backwards from the H-1B cap deadline. USCIS opens registration in March for a fiscal year starting October 1, so you'll want an offer in hand no later than February to give SSR's HR and legal team adequate preparation time. Starting your job search six to nine months before you need new sponsorship is the safest approach, especially if your OPT or current status has a fixed end date.
